Many students simply list events from their lives without explaining why those experiences mattered. An autobiography should not read like a diary or a list of dates.

Your instructor wants to understand your journey, not just the sequence of events.
Reflection is what makes an autobiography meaningful. Simply describing experiences is not enough.

Thoughtful reflection demonstrates critical thinking and makes your assignment more engaging.
Although autobiographies are personal, academic assignments still require professional language. Excessive slang, abbreviations, or overly casual expressions can reduce the quality of your work.

Jumping randomly between childhood, college, and recent experiences confuses readers. Every section should connect smoothly to the next.
Organize your assignment using headings and paragraphs that guide the reader naturally through your story. Transitional phrases also improve readability and coherence.
